          Subject: Department of Health and Human Services, Centers for Medicare and
                  Medicaid Services: Medicaid Program; Time Limitation on Price
                  Recalculations and Recordkeeping Requirements Under the Drug Rebate
                  Program

          Pursuant to section 801(a)(2)(A) of title 5, United States Code, this is our report on a
          major rule promulgated by the Department of Health and Human Services, Centers
          for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S), entitled Medicaid Program; Time
          Limitation on Price Recalculations and Recordkeeping Requirements Under the Drug
          Rebate Program (RIN: 0938-AM20). We received the rule on September 4, 2003. It
          was published in the Federal Register as a final rule on August 29, 2003. 68 Fed. Reg.
          51912.

          The final rule establishes new recordkeeping requirements for drug manufacturers
          under the Medicaid drug rebate program and sets a 3-year time limitation during
          which manufacturers must report changes to average manufacturer price and best
          price for purposes of reporting data to CMS.

          The final rule has an announced effective date of October 1, 2003. The
          Congressional Review Act requires a 60-day delay in the effective date of a major
          rule from the date of publication in the Federal Register or receipt of the rule by
          Congress, whichever is later. 5 U.S.C. 801(a)(3)(A). As noted above, the rule was
          published on August 29, 2003, and was received by Congress on September 4, 2003.
          Therefore, the rule does not have the required delay in its effective date.
